#60775e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60775e is composed of 37.6% red, 46.7%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 21%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 115.2 degrees, a saturation of 11.7% and a lightness of 41.8%. #60775e color hex could be obtained by blending #c0eebc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#60775e color description : Dark grayish lime green.
#60775e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60775e has RGB values of R:96, G:119,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 6322014.
